The Impact of Lyrical Dance on Mental Health: How the Art Form Can Promote Healing and Self-Discovery

Lyrical dance is a powerful form of self-expression that can have a profound impact on mental health. This art form combines elements of ballet, jazz, and contemporary dance to create a unique and expressive style that can help individuals explore their emotions and connect with their inner selves.

Benefits of Lyrical Dance for Mental Health

There are many benefits to engaging in lyrical dance as a form of self-expression and mental health support. Some of the key benefits include:

  • Stress relief: Lyrical dance can help to reduce stress and anxiety by providing a healthy outlet for emotions and allowing individuals to express themselves physically.
  • Improved self-esteem: As individuals become more comfortable with their bodies and their movements, they may experience an increase in self-esteem and self-confidence.
  • Increased emotional awareness: Lyrical dance encourages individuals to connect with their emotions and express them through movement, which can lead to greater emotional awareness and understanding.
  • Social connection: Lyrical dance can be a social activity that brings people together and helps to build connections and relationships.

How to Get Started with Lyrical Dance

If you're interested in exploring the benefits of lyrical dance for your mental health, here are some steps to get started:

  1. Find a class or instructor: Look for a local dance studio or instructor that offers lyrical dance classes. You can also find online classes or tutorials if you prefer to learn at home.
  2. Choose the right attire: Wear comfortable clothing that allows you to move freely. Ballet shoes or bare feet are typically worn for lyrical dance.
  3. Warm up and stretch: Before you begin dancing, it's important to warm up and stretch your muscles to prevent injury.
  4. Focus on your emotions: Lyrical dance is all about expressing your emotions through movement. Allow yourself to connect with your feelings and use them to guide your movements.
  5. Practice regularly: Like any form of exercise, regular practice is key to seeing improvements in your mental health and overall well-being.
